Got my name added on to the end of an RR day list at Ecosse in Bo'Ness with 106owners.co.uk and... another pug website.

Myself, my brother (vxr) and my mate Ross (106gti) had a 3 car convoy to the event, Eck was supposed to come but he slept in...





The VXR never went on the rollers as my brother had to leave but my mate was one of the first to go on, he was hoping for 145 and he got 145.5bhp so he was chuffed.




It was then my turn and after the mechanic putting my car into fourth thinking it was reverse it got on the rollers...




I was hoping for 118 but got 128bhp which i am happy about considering how much i have spent.
